tiny,very small
minute
to tame; to bring plants or animals under human control
domesticate
n. 1. A thin, threadlike part of animal hair or plant tissue; also, an artificial thread that resembles this. 2. An arrangement of body cells that forms muscles and nerves. 3. A food substance that provides bulk but is not digested.
fiber
v. 1. To lose; to give up. 2. To cause to flow. 3. To throw off water without letting it soak through. 4. To send out or give off.
shed
v. 1. To make or become liquid. 2. To bring or to come to an end.
dissolve
n. 1. Movement. 2. A suggestion on which members at a meeing must vote. v. To signal. adj. Not moving; stationary.
motion
v. To cover with something that protects.
sheathe
to come into view; to appear
emerge
v. 1. To come or to bring forth from an egg. 2. To think up. n. A small opening with a door or cover.
hatch
n. The things that are worn by a person; clothing
apparel
v. To serve a purpose. n. 1. The special purpose something is used for. 2. An important ceremony or gathering.
function
v. To prevent from doing something or to prevent from happening. adj. Held back because of shyness.
inhibit
